Masonry repair services involve the restoration and preservation of existing brick, stone, and concrete structures. This work typically includes fixing cracks, replacing damaged masonry units, repointing mortar joints, and addressing issues caused by weathering or structural shifts. Skilled technicians assess the condition of masonry elements and perform targeted repairs to restore stability, appearance, and functionality. Proper masonry repair not only enhances the visual appeal of a property but also helps extend the lifespan of the structure by preventing further deterioration.
Many common problems in masonry structures can be effectively addressed through professional repair services. These issues often include cracked or crumbling brickwork, loose or missing mortar, efflorescence, and water infiltration that can lead to internal damage. Repairing these problems helps maintain the integrity of foundations, walls, chimneys, and facades, reducing the risk of more costly repairs down the line. Addressing masonry damage early can also improve safety by preventing potential structural failures.

Cost Range for Masonry Repairs - Typical expenses for masonry repair services vary depending on the scope of work. For minor crack repairs or tuckpointing, costs often range from $500 to $2,500. Larger projects, such as rebuilding or extensive restoration, can cost $3,000 to $10,000 or more.
Factors Influencing Masonry Repair Costs - The total cost depends on the type of masonry material, the extent of damage, and accessibility. For example, repairing a small brick wall might cost around $1,000, while restoring a large stone facade could reach $15,000.
Average Cost per Square Foot - Masonry repair services typically charge between $10 and $30 per square foot. This includes tasks like repointing mortar joints or replacing damaged bricks, with costs increasing for more complex or custom work.
Additional Expenses to Consider - Costs may also include surface preparation, removal of debris, or scaffolding rentals, which can add several hundred dollars to the project. Contact local pros for detailed estimates based on specific repair needs.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What types of masonry repair services are available? Local masonry professionals offer a range of services including crack repair, mortar repointing, brick replacement, and structural reinforcement to address various issues with masonry structures.
How can I tell if my masonry needs repair? Signs indicating the need for masonry repair include visible cracks, crumbling mortar, loose bricks, or water infiltration around the structure.
What causes damage to masonry structures? Common causes of masonry damage include weathering, settling or shifting of the foundation, moisture infiltration, and aging of materials.
Are there different materials used for masonry repair? Yes, repair materials vary based on the original construction and may include matching mortar, brick, or stone to ensure seamless repairs.
How long does masonry repair typically take? The duration of masonry repair depends on the extent of the damage and the scope of work, with more extensive repairs taking longer to complete.
